Flood Impacts 🅘

  • 18 - Major flood stage. Extensive flooding of agricultural land and inundation of structures and roads.
  • 16 - Moderate flood stage. Extensive flooding of agricultural land with some inundation of structures and roads possible.
  • 12 - Flood stage. Flooding of agricultural land begins.

Historic Crests

1. 17.89 ft on 05-31-1991
2. 16.71 ft on 05-28-1996
3. 16.59 ft on 05-22-2019
4. 15.75 ft on 02-08-1997
5. 14.39 ft on 06-03-1997
